LGBT Great is looking for an enthusiastic individual to join their Data Governance team as an Apprentice. This entry-level role involves learning on the job while studying for a Level 4 qualification in Data Protection and Information Governance over a 14-18 month programme.
You will be responsible for:
- Maintaining data records
- Supporting risk assessments
- Responding to queries
- Assisting in training
No prior experience is required, and full training will be provided.
